ζοφο-δορπίδας

zophodorpidas · ὁ

supping in the dark

Generated live from the audited corpus — every figure on this page is a database query, not prose from memory.

What it meant — LSJ

supping in the dark, in secret

supping in the dark or in secret, of Pittacus, Alc. 37 B, cf. Plu. QConv. 2.726a: ζοφοδορπίας in Theognost. Can. 20, Zonar.; ζοφο-δερκίας, Hsch., Suid.
